Abstract

Flexible-bending, as a new bending technology, is widely used in the processing of profiles and tubes, especially in the production of small batches and multi-curvature. In flexible-bending process of tubes, the stress is complex and the springback problem exists which affects the forming accuracy and quality of bent tubes. In this paper, the springback is studied and solved by springback compensation by means of finite element numerical simulation and experimental verification. The results show that the wall thickness of tubes and the bending radii have important influence on springback. Springback compensation can effectively solve the problem of forming error caused by springback because that the forming radii after compensation can approach the target radius gradually. The experiments were carried out with flexible-bending equipment. The simulation results were in agreement with the experiments, which proved the reliability of the simulation.
